Some of the most common reasons for PowerPoint file size to increase are using multiple images, using large images, or embedding elements such as fonts, video or audio directly in the presentation file. An easy way to reduce the file size is to use special compression programs designed for PowerPoint files.
STEPS TO COMPRESS IMAGES: WINDOWS - MICROSOFT POWERPOINT Open your PowerPoint file. Select a slide that contains an image or picture. Select the image or picture. Click the Picture Format ribbon at the top of the screen. Click Compress Pictures.

To change the slide size: Select the Design tab of the toolbar ribbon. Select Page Setup on the left end of the toolbar. In the Page Setup dialog box, under Slides sized for, choose the predefined size you want, or choose Custom and specify the dimensions you want.
